Introspection ( noun) خود نگری، باطن بین، خود شناسی

the examination or observation of one’s own mental and emotional processes.
Example: “quiet introspection can be extremely valuable”
Synonyms: brooding, self-analysis, soul-searching, heart-searching, introversion, self-observation, self-absorption
Antonyms: extrospection


Unsavoury ( adjective) اخلاقی طور پر ناگوار، بدمزہ، بدذائقہ

disagreeable to taste, smell, or look at.
Example: “they looked at the scanty, unsavoury portions of food doled out to them”
Synonyms: unpalatable, unappetizing, unpleasant, distasteful, disagreeable, uninviting, unappealing
Antonyms: tasty, appetizing


Unscrupulous ( adjective) بے ایمان، بے اصول، آزاد

having or showing no moral principles; not honest or fair.
Example: “unscrupulous landlords might be tempted to harass existing tenants”
Synonyms: unprincipled, unethical, immoral, amoral, conscienceless, untrustworthy, shameless, reprobate
Antonyms: ethical, honest


Grudge ( noun) بغض، رنجش، عذر

a persistent feeling of ill will or resentment resulting from a past insult or injury.
Example: “I’ve never been one to hold a grudge”
Synonyms: grievance, resentment, bitterness, rancour, pique, umbrage, displeasure, dissatisfaction
Antonyms: friendliness, good will, happiness, kindness


Bonhomie ( noun) کشادہ دلی، دوستانہ، خوش اخلاقی،ملنساری

cheerful friendliness; geniality.
Example: “he exuded good humour and bonhomie”
Synonyms: geniality, congeniality, conviviality, cordiality, affability, amiability, sociability, friendliness
Antonyms: coldness


Clandestine ( adjective) پوشیدہ، چوری چھپے، مخفی

kept secret or done secretively, especially because illicit.
Example: “she deserved better than these clandestine meetings”
Synonyms: secret, covert, furtive, surreptitious, stealthy, cloak-and-dagger, hole-and-corner
Antonyms: open, above board


Gush ( verb) اچانک تیزی سے بہنا، تیزی سے پانی بہنا

(of a liquid) flow out of something in a rapid and plentiful stream.
Example: “water gushed out of the washing machine”
Synonyms: surge, burst, spout, spurt, jet, stream, rush, pour, spill, well out, cascade
Antonyms: drip, drop, dribble, trickle


Suspicion ( noun) بدگمانی، شکی فطرت، مشکوک

a feeling or thought that something is possible, likely, or true.
Example: “she had a sneaking suspicion that he was laughing at her”
Synonyms: intuition, feeling, impression, inkling, surmise, guess, conjecture, speculation, hunch
Antonyms: certainty


Potentate ( noun) سلطان، حکمران، بادشاہ، مقتدر

a monarch or ruler, especially an autocratic one.

Synonyms: ruler, head of state, monarch, sovereign, king, queen, emperor, empress, prince
Antonyms: servant, inferior, follower


Escalate ( verb) شدت بڑھانا، تیزی، زیادہ کرنا

increase rapidly.
Example: “the price of tickets escalated”
Synonyms: increase rapidly, soar, rocket, shoot up, mount, surge, spiral, grow rapidly, rise rapidly
Antonyms: plunge
